Your nervous system learned something very early:
Pain means wrong.
Relief means right.
Trading breaks that rule.
Correct decisions can produce pain.
Incorrect decisions can produce relief.
If you don’t consciously separate emotional feedback from decision quality, your brain will keep optimizing for comfort instead of profit.
